Experienced software engineer specializing in backend development, cloud integrations, and scalable microservices with a focus on financial and data-driven applications.
Used extensively for backend development, microservice architecture, and system integration across multiple projects.
Developed fault-tolerant APIs, microservices, and backend features in various enterprise applications.
Built event-driven architectures and real-time data pipelines with Kafka for scalable data processing.
Deployed and migrated services to cloud platforms, implementing cloud-native solutions for scalability and security.
The Neo Solutions
Built and scaled a regulatory-compliant microfinance platform in KSA, serving 20K+ customers with loan origination, recurring loans and repayment integrations., Developed core systems for compliance and decision-making, including an Admin Portal for loan tracking, auditing features aligned with...
Self Employed
Hosted a custom NVIDIA NeMo ASR model on a GCP VM and connected it to an Angular frontend via a Java WebSocket middleware, enabling real-time transcription. Delivered a tailored solution for a language-learning platform, enhancing accuracy and user experience., Building event-driven architectures...
Alex Solutions
Contributed to the core service of a Metadata Management Framework by creating and enhancing data scanners and connectors. Delivered solutions under an agile methodology to meet rapid customer demands, supporting customer retention and minimizing churn., Enhanced Azure Synapse and Azure Data...
Confiz
BS Computer Science
Discover other professionals with similar experience
Designed and integrated microservices in payment processing, data management, and compliance systems.
Designed and implemented core backend features for an ETL data pipeline project, including fault-tolerant APIs, Notebook APIs, and Airflow integration to provide deep insights into orchestration platforms. Resolved critical production issues within strict SLAs., Automated testing for complex ETL...
Cloud Card Inc.
Specialized in the Payment Card Industry (PCI) with expertise in designing and developing scalable, robust microservices for payment processing, ensuring strict PCI compliance., Developed an embedded finance API for seamless integration with third-party financial services, including card creation,...
Trangolabs
Full-Stack Java Developer for a Sweden-based client, customizing a CPQ product to reduce quotation processing time from days to hours., Led a team of 3 developers, interviewed 20+ candidates, and successfully hired/trained 5+ team members on a complex CPQ product., Collaborated with a leading...